Responsibilities
  • Maintain safe and smooth‑running physical hotel property and grounds.
  • Complete repairs and preventative maintenance on plumbing, electrical, refrigeration, kitchen equipment and HVAC systems.
  • Perform light carpentry, painting, vinyl and drywall repair.
  • Implement and monitor programs to ensure a safe facility and work environment in compliance with ergonomic, emergency response and injury prevention regulations.
  • Keep detailed records and reports.
  • Provide ongoing training to Maintenance Tech I team members.
  • Collaborate with management to recruit for department needs.
  • Contribute to an exceptional guest experience by providing courteous and friendly guest service.
Qualifications
  • Self‑motivated and organized with a can‑do spirit.
  • Advanced maintenance knowledge and skills to handle all aspects of hotel maintenance.
  • Ability to complete partial or full dismantling of equipment for repair or replacement.
  • Knowledge of water chemistry, water testing, filtration and mechanical operations for pool maintenance.
  • Experience implementing and monitoring preventative maintenance programs.
  • Knowledge of building maintenance, including minor electrical repair and plumbing.
  • Proficiency in spoken, written, and received direction in English.
  • Ability to troubleshoot and repair machinery faults using testing methods.
  • Flexibility to be available for emergency repair.
